Job Description

Overview

Marketing Coordinator, Email and Engagement reports to the Marketing Manager and supports multiple functions within HGOs Audiences Department. The role involves crafting email campaigns and supporting advertising and promotional efforts to promote the HGO brand and increase sales, retention, and engagement for single ticket, subscription, and group sales. The position supports various audience growth initiatives and executes tasks to reach marketing objectives, including continued audience engagement and expansion to new audiences.

Key Responsibilities


  • Support email marketing and database communication efforts, including upkeep of calendar, email creation, copywriting, proofing, editing, testing and reporting.
  • Work closely with marketing and communications colleagues to ensure messaging for each email communication and department initiative is clearly and accurately communicated and executed within HGO brand guidelines.
  • Ensure cross-departmental collaboration on asset development for email marketing efforts by submitting timely requests for designs, videos, blog articles, etc. needs that provide colleagues with clear direction and timelines.
  • Assist Marketing Manager with the upkeep of email marketing calendar to ensure successful email campaigns, appropriate timing of communications, and seamless cross-departmental communications within HGO including the Butler Studio, Community & Learning, Philanthropy, and Special Events.
  • Execute promotional plans created to strategically target consumers whether a designated demographic or an audience with unique connections to an opera, as well as new-to-opera guests. Efforts include support for existing affinity groups, as well as development of promotional codes, theme nights, add-on offerings, cross-promotional strategies with other organizations, etc.
  • Assist Marketing Manager on execution of multi-channel promotions and advertising plans to support subscription and single ticket sales, as well as community initiatives, events, programs, and other initiatives. This includes managing deliverables tied to paid, organic, trade and barter activities.
  • Execute initiatives designed to increase audiences for our email subscriptions, database, sales leads, and social media following. Partner with colleagues to track and report progress on a regular basis.
  • Support all grassroots activations intended to reach new audiences such as HGOs marketing presence at Giving Voice, Carols on the Green, Miller Outdoor Theater, and other Wortham Theater Center events. Provide Administrative support to the Marketing team as requested including data entry, report generation, inventory, organization, accounting tasks, and other office management duties as requested.
  • Support merchandise and promotional item efforts for the department including sourcing samples, keeping inventory, and executing fulfillment.
  • Perform various other tasks that may be assigned by the Marketing Manager, Director of Marketing or Chief Marketing & Experience Officer.


Qualifications
  • Bachelors degree in marketing, communications, advertising, or sales preferred.
  • 1-3 years relevant experience required.
  • Proficiency in writing is required. Writing samples will be requested.
  • Experience working in an email marketing platform (Active Campaign, Constant Contact, MailChimp, WordFly, Prospect2) preferred.
  • Experience working in a CRM database system (especially Tessitura) is a plus.
  • Background in performing arts is a plus.
  • Must be able to work some evenings/weekends.
